The Couch Critic Logo
The Couch CriticCouch Critic
TrendingMoviesTV ShowsListsReviewsWhat to Watch
LogoThe Couch Critic

Menu

TrendingMoviesTV ShowsListsReviewsWhat to Watch

© 2026 The Couch Critic

The Couch Critic Logo

The Couch Critic

Your go-to destination for honest movie and TV show reviews from a passionate community of critics. Join the conversation today.

X

Explore

  • Trending
  • Movies
  • TV Shows
  • Reviews
  • Lists
  • Games
  • About Us

Categories

  • Popular Movies
  • Trending Now
  • Upcoming
  • Airing Today
  • Movie Genres
  • TV Genres

Community

  • Guides
  • What to Watch

Legal

  • Privacy Policy
  • Terms of Service
  • Cookie Policy
  • RSS Feed
© 2026 The Couch Critic.•Built by Hayden Thorn
Cookie Settings
The Movie Database

This application uses TMDB and the TMDB APIs but is not endorsed, certified, or otherwise approved by TMDB.

Where Have All the Flowers Gone
Where Have All the Flowers Gone
  1. Movies
  2. Where Have All the Flowers Gone

Where Have All the Flowers Gone

Original Title: 那时花开

2002
1h 30m
Romance

Status

Released

Release

2002

Runtime

1h 30m

Storyline

Gao Ju (Xia Yu) and Zhang Yang (Pu Shu) were best of friends, but they fall in love with Huanzi (Zhou Xun). Huanzi loves both of them and thus they formed an unbalanced trinity. A simple promise not to meet ever again after college ended up in disaster when Gao cannot resist wooing Huanzi again

Score Distribution

Details

Status
Released
Runtime
1h 30m
May 1, 2002
Languages
Mandarin
Director
Gao Xiaosong
Gao Xiaosong
Production Countries
China

Top Cast

6 Cast Members

Zhou Xun

Zhou Xun

欢子

Xia Yu

Xia Yu

高举

Pu Shu

Pu Shu

张扬

Li Ming

Li Ming

老王

Shu Yaoxuan

Shu Yaoxuan

Zhen Tian

Zhen Tian

Recommended Movies